Q: Is 25,833,756 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 25,833,756 is a composite number.

Why is 25,833,756 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 25,833,756 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 13 26 39 52 78 156 165,601 331,202 496,803 662,404 993,606 1,987,212 2,152,813 4,305,626 6,458,439 8,611,252 12,916,878 and 25,833,756, with no remainder.

Since 25,833,756 cannot be divided by just 1 and 25,833,756, it is a composite number.
